Questions and Answers

What is the purpose of taking notes during lectures or seminars?

The purpose of taking notes during lectures or seminars is to store information until it is ready to be used, aid in revision, use during assignments or exams, during group work, and as a record of research.

Why is it impossible to remember all the information that is given during lectures or seminars?

It is impossible to remember all the information that is given during lectures or seminars because there is often too much information to retain without note-taking.

What are some benefits of taking notes?

Some benefits of taking notes include aiding in revision, providing a reference for assignments or exams, facilitating group work, and serving as a record of research.
